Handover note — Priya to Dalen (for support visibility)

The WashPort locker access flow now requires a fresh session token before the door-release call; cached tokens older than ten minutes are rejected. If a customer reports a locker that won't open, first confirm the app shows the green "session active" badge, then retry once. Escalate only after two failed releases, noting the locker bay number. Full troubleshooting steps and escalation paths are documented on the internal page here:

runbook for tafof-yawif: https://confluence.tolvaqsys.internal/display/display/browse/pages/7be3

## Signing Timetabler Releases

So you're cutting a release of Chalkwise, our school timetable solver. Nice. Every build that leaves CI must be signed before the district portals will accept it — unsigned bundles get silently rejected, and you'll waste an afternoon wondering why. Run the sign step from the release container, not your laptop, and double-check the version tag first. The signing key you need for that step is below.

rollout seal: bky4_x7Gc

**Break-Glass Access — Tixwell Pricing Experiment Service**

New team members: the Tixwell dynamic ticket-pricing experiment runs behind restricted controls because live price changes affect real customers. Normal changes go through the experiment review board. Break-glass access exists only for halting a runaway pricing variant. Use of it pages the duty lead and creates a mandatory incident record. If the standard kill switch is unreachable, authenticate to the emergency console with the recovery passphrase below.

unlock words, yawig-kagef: gordor-holvan-ulaael-pramir-ulaiel-tamdor

# Pricing — Tarnow Product Line (Managers Only)

Current list pricing for the Tarnow line holds through end of quarter: Core at 49/seat, Plus at 89/seat, Enterprise custom. Floor discount authority: 15% for managers, 25% with VP sign-off. Competitive pressure from Solvex has increased in the mid-market tier; do not match below floor without escalation. Renewal uplift capped at 7%. Changes take effect next cycle and will be communicated directly. A confidential note on forthcoming plans is recorded below.

management briefing: Project Ulavan slips by two quarters because of the staffing delay.